The most widely used crude topping column in refineries is the ______________ column?
Correct answer: A. Bubble-cap
- A. Bubble-cap
- B. Packed bed
- C. Fluidised bed
- D. Perforated plate
Explanation
Bubble-cap trays provide good vapour-liquid contact and tolerate changes in liquid and vapour rates, making them a traditional choice for crude topping columns. Packed and fluidised beds are not the usual tray-column arrangement for this service.
